<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>In the current context of </span><strong><em><span>nearshoring</span></em></strong><span> and Mexico&#8217;s growing integration into </span><strong><span>global supply chains</span></strong><span>  , a new era is dawning for the country&#8217;s transportation sector, which represents not only an opportunity for economic development, but also a challenge.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>In order to position Mexican transport companies in the international market and take advantage of the opportunities offered by foreign direct investment, </span><a href="https://tiastica.com/"><span>Tiastica</span></a><span> , </span><a href="http://www.grupoezencial.com/"><span>Grupo Ezencial</span></a><span> , </span><a href="https://www.gmtransport.com/"><span>GM Transport</span></a><span> , </span><a href="https://www.alibaba.com/"><span>Alibaba</span></a><span> and T21 have joined forces in an unprecedented alliance.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>The main objective of this collaboration is </span><strong><span>to promote the digital transformation of the sector</span></strong><span> by investing in advanced data science and analytics tools, which will allow the creation of a </span><em><span>benchmark</span></em><span> at a national level, offering each company a </span><strong><span>detailed diagnosis of its level of digital maturity and pointing out the areas of opportunity</span></strong><span> in strategic, operational, commercial, financial and fiscal aspects.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Adimir Benítez, director of Strategic Solutions at Tiastica, explained that when trying to gather valuable information, it is always very dispersed, even though large chambers have a lot of data statistics.</span></span></p>
<bl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>“It is a very difficult task, the information is very fragmented and the risk is that global chains are already here. We want to form an alliance that allows us to collect data to provide the transport sector with the ability to implement an effective digital transformation and prepare to compete against large conglomerates,” he said.</span></span></p>
</bl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>For his part, Gustavo Vargas, founding partner and CEO of Grupo Ezencial, emphasized the importance of </span><strong><span>working together</span></strong><span> on this project, since through interviews they have conducted, they found that the fundamental factor that large companies will require in the short and medium term is technology, from ERP systems and traceability to the ability to generate data in real time.</span></span></p>
<bl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>“We are facing an economic environment that could be very favourable, but to take advantage of it we need to work as a team. If we do not support and integrate each other, other foreign players will position themselves to take advantage of these opportunities,” he said.</span></span></p>
</bl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Therefore, the first step is </span><strong><span>to register for the initiative</span></strong><span> , in which they will be sent an invitation to interact with a robot, through which they will be able to exchange information confidentially.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>On March 24, a digital demo of a transport company will be presented, showing how to boost its growth and economic acceleration.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Analytical dashboard options can be displayed to make the company more profitable, ensure business continuity and provide a risk map.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><em><span>In addition, a benchmark</span></em><span> will be built that, through interaction with a robot, will allow the business&#8217; maturity to be assessed in terms of strategy, sales, supply chain, financial and tax management, among other aspects.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>This initiative not only seeks </span><strong><span>to modernize the sector, but also to prepare transport companies to compete in a global market</span></strong><span> that increasingly demands more technology and efficiency.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>By participating, entrepreneurs will be able to identify their strengths, recognize their areas for improvement and chart a clear path toward digital transformation.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>The invitation is open to all stakeholders in the transportation sector in Mexico and registration will allow access to exclusive information, activities and key dates to be part of this ambitious project.</span></span></p>

<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Within the framework of the publication of the project </span><em><span>Diagnosis of the Labor Situation of the Automotive Sector in Mexico,</span></em><span> implemented by the </span><a href="https://www.padf.org/"><span>Pan American Development Foundation (PADF)</span></a><span> , in collaboration with the </span><a href="https://www.udec.edu.mx/"><span>University of Celaya</span></a><span> and the </span><a href="https://ina.com.mx/"><span>National Auto Parts Industry (INA)</span></a><span> , the results of the longitudinal study were presented that highlights the impact of the labor reform in the automotive sector, and how companies in the sector have adopted the provisions of the reform and Chapter 23 of the Treaty between Mexico, the United States and Canada (T-MEC), with the purpose of improving labor relations and promoting regulatory compliance.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>The document assessed progress on key issues such as </span><strong><span>freedom of association, gender equality, prevention of violence and discrimination, as well as </span></strong></span><span class="s1"><strong><span>social dialogue</span></strong><span> .</span></span></p>
<bl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s2"><span>“This analysis will allow us to design specific training to close the identified gaps and support the transition to a more inclusive and democratic work culture,” said Edgar Lee, project director.</span></span></p>
</bl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>The assessment included a quantitative survey of 261 companies and in-depth interviews with 26 industry leaders.</span></span><span> Among the companies assessed, 59% are large organizations with more than 250 employees, while 30% are medium-sized and 11% are small. The study also included an assessment by region and company size to identify specific trends.</span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Ana Cuevas, a researcher at the University of Celaya, pointed out that </span><strong><span>75% of the companies surveyed have already legitimized their collective contracts</span></strong><span> , and 76% obtained an approval level between 81% and 100%, &#8220;which reinforces transparency and union democracy,&#8221; she said.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>He also noted that companies reported significant progress in </span><strong><span>violence prevention and freedom of association</span></strong><span> , both evaluated with an average of 4.3 out of 5 points.</span></span></p>
<bl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>&#8220;The automotive sector has stood out compared to other sectors in the modernization of its unions and in compliance with labor regulations, although traditional practices persist in some cases,&#8221; said Roberto Kuhlmann, a researcher at the University of Celaya.</span></span></p>
</bl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>On the other hand, Cuevas indicated that, despite an increase in the participation of women in operational and administrative areas, gaps persist in leadership positions. She </span></span><span class="s1"><span>also said that large companies have </span><strong><span>more structured policies, while small companies present specific efforts</span></strong><span> , &#8220;such as flexible schedules and breastfeeding rooms, but they lack institutional strategies,&#8221; she added.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Regarding the prevention of violence and discrimination, the implementation of </span><strong><span>NOM-035</span></strong><span> has strengthened policies on this issue, however, challenges related to work stress persist due to the dynamics of the industry and </span><em><span>just-in-time</span></em><span> deliveries .</span></span></p>
<bl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>“Where there are clear regulations, such as NOM-035 and the labor reform, more concrete progress is observed,” Kulhmann added.</span></span></p>
</blockquote>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Despite progress, the assessment revealed that smaller companies face difficulties in implementing comprehensive strategies, especially in areas of gender equality and social dialogue. </span></span><span class="s1"><span>In addition, less regulated areas such as the prevention of discrimination require greater attention.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>Edgar Lee added that </span><strong><span>over the next 20 months, the PADF will intensify training efforts to close the identified gaps</span></strong><span> and support companies in the transition to a more inclusive and law-compliant work culture.</span></span></p>
<p class="p1"><span class="s1"><span>According to experts, the study shows notable progress in regulatory compliance, but underlines the need for greater investment in comprehensive labor strategies, especially for small and medium-sized companies.</span></span></p>
